Overview

This book focusses on structural bonding, including many facets, like fundamental aspects of adhesion, science and technology of surfaces, adhesive materials, mechanical properties of bonded joints, innovative designs and applications, testing and standardization, industrial aspects, quality procedures, environmental and ecological aspects. This first volume of the new series gathers selected contributions of the 6th international conference on structural adhesive bonding AB 2021, held in Porto, Portugal, 8-9 July 2021, represents the latest trends and serves as a reference volume for researchers and graduate students working in this field.

Table of Contents

Chapter 1. Open assembly time of water-borne polyvinyl acetate (PVAc) wood adhesives affected by various factors.- Chapter 2. Engineering technology and preparation of coating systems made with epoxy resin-based bonding agents modified with the addition of granite powder sourced from quarry wastes.- Chapter 3. Mechanical and adhesive properties of cement-lime plasters modified with waste granite powder.- Chapter 4. Characterization of fast adhesive curing reactions - A novel experimental setup.- Chapter 5. Material Extrusion on Enameled Steel Surfaces.- Chapter 6. The effect of the viscosity and the contact angle on the pull-off strength of epoxy resin modified with waste granite powders.- Chapter 7. Investigation of the Cleaning Effectiveness of Laser Radiation for Improved Adhesion on Glass Dust Contaminated Glass Fiber Reinforced Polyamide 6.- Chapter 8. Structural bonding of thin-walled magnesium die cast components.- Chapter 9. The behaviour of CFRP adhesive joints under differentloading rates.- Chapter 10. Long-term resistant bonding between wood and aluminium alloy for hybrid lightweight composites.- Chapter 11. Multiaxial fatigue life assessment of adhesive joints based on the concepts of critical planes: Stress-based approaches.

Author Information

Lucas FM da Silva is Full Professor at the Department of Mechanical Engineering at the Faculty of Engineering of the University of Porto (FEUP). He leads the Advanced Joining Processes Unit (AJPU) of the Institute of Science and Innovation in Mechanical Engineering and Industrial Engineering (INEGI). He is Editor-in-Chief of The Journal of Adhesion. Robert D. Adams is Emeritus Professor of Applied Mechanics at the University of Bristol and Visiting Professor at the Universities of Oxford and Oxford Brookes. In 2011, he was awarded the R.L. Patrick Fellowship of the US Adhesion Society. He has been Joint Editor-in-Chief of the International Journal of Adhesion and Adhesives since 1999.
